To share reports between organizations, you must first create a report template. Read here about how to do it.
When a report template is created and saved, it can be found in "Template Library" under "Tools" in the left tab. To find your saved templates, go to the "Publish template" tab. Click "Publish" to share with other organizations or users.
Here, you can choose whether you or the organization will be the creator. Also, click the visibility you want for the report template. If you select "Public," all users in Boardeaser will have access to the report template, and "Private" visibility will only give access to the members of your organization. If you select "Hidden," only selected members will have access.
After you click "Publish", you can share the report template with other users. If you publish the report template as "Hidden", it may be important to do so.
Now other organizations or users can access your report template by clicking Tools > Template Library in the left menu. Locate shared report packages and click the "Save" button. You will then be able to find saved report templates by clicking Reports > Report Templates in the left menu.
